Garth Brooks – March 24th – Pepsi Center

Estimated read time 7 min read

On Tuesday night the Pepsi Center was a sea of denim, cowboy hats, belt buckles and short shorts. To say the atmosphere in the arena was electric as showtime approached would be doing a disservice to the thousands of buzzing fans who could barely sit still as they snapped selfies with the giant “G” that sat center stage on a huge digital cube. When it was all over Brooks had proven that he deserves the accolades that are showered upon him. He’s truly one of the greatest performers out there today.

Revenge of the 90’s III – March 30th – Cervantes’

Estimated read time 6 min read

The 90’s were back in full force on Saturday night at Cervates’ as J2G Live threw their annual 90’s Night party with some of the best musicians in Denver doing the heavy lifting. There were tons of costumes that confused the best of 80’s fashion (Neon) with the best of 90’s (Flannel) and a ton of girls even got their hair crimped for the occasion. It was great to see people getting so into the spirit of the party and it was clear that 90’s Night grabbed a firm foothold in the Denver music scene in it’s third year.
